引言
黑盒测试是软件测试领域的一种重要方法,它通过在不了解内部结构和代码的情况下,对软件的功能进行测试。随着全球软件行业的快速发展,黑盒测试技术成为了许多跨国公司争相招聘的技能。本文将深入探讨黑盒测试技术,并分析如何通过掌握这些技能,在海外职场中寻找新的机遇,甚至实现移民海外的目标。
黑盒测试技术概述
1. 定义
黑盒测试是一种完全不考虑软件内部结构和实现细节的测试方法。测试人员只关注软件的功能和性能,通过输入测试数据,验证输出是否符合预期。
2. 测试类型
- 功能测试:验证软件的功能是否符合需求规格。
- 性能测试:评估软件在特定条件下的性能表现。
- 兼容性测试:确保软件在不同操作系统、浏览器和硬件平台上都能正常运行。
3. 测试工具
- Selenium:用于自动化Web应用测试。
- JIRA:用于跟踪和管理软件缺陷。
- Bugzilla:一个开源的缺陷跟踪系统。
掌握黑盒测试技术的优势
1. 职业发展
- 高需求:随着软件行业的增长,黑盒测试人员的需求也在不断上升。
- 薪资待遇:黑盒测试人员通常享有较高的薪资待遇。
2. 海外职场机遇
- 跨国公司:许多跨国公司需要黑盒测试人员来确保其软件产品的质量。
- 远程工作:黑盒测试工作通常可以远程进行,为海外工作提供了便利。
如何在海外职场中利用黑盒测试技术
1. 学习和认证
- 在线课程:参加在线课程,如Coursera、Udemy等,学习黑盒测试技术。
- 专业认证:获得如ISTQB(国际软件测试资格认证)等认证,提高自己的竞争力。
2. 实践经验
- 实习机会:寻找实习机会,积累实际工作经验。
- 开源项目:参与开源项目,提升自己的实战能力。
3. 移民政策了解
- 了解各国移民政策:了解目标国家的移民政策,如工作签证、永久居留等。
- 职业评估:了解目标国家对于特定职业的评估标准。
结论
黑盒测试技术是软件测试领域的一项重要技能,掌握这项技术不仅可以为个人职业发展带来机遇,还可以在海外职场中寻找新的发展空间。通过不断学习和实践,掌握黑盒测试技术,你将能够更好地应对全球软件行业的发展,并在海外职场中实现自己的梦想。
